Overview
An advanced solution tailored for cameras, imagers, embedded AI appliances, and next-generation Point-of-Sale (POS) machines that includes low-power, scalable, accelerated AI and versatile IO options for parallel sensor processing that future-proof your product design.
Parallel architecture enables real time insights from multiple inputs.
Further accelerates analytics operation efficiency with pruning.
Adaptable hardware and software increases flexibility.
Enables efficient AI computing.
